**Ticket DD-771: Dedup job failing — wrong env**

The Merletree dedup pipeline is matching zero customer records in staging. Cause: env file points at the sandbox match index. Plugin authors: set `DEDUP_INDEX=staging-primary` and `MATCH_THRESHOLD=0.85`. Do not reuse sandbox configs. Fuzzy-match plugins must also declare `PLUGIN_MODE=batch` or they'll be throttled. After those changes, the pipeline authenticates against the Corvane match service, which requires this line in the env file:

env line for kageg-fajof: COURIER_KEY5=93d14

# Break-Glass: Catalog Cache Invalidation

Scope: the Pinrow product catalog at Veldstone Retail. If stale prices persist after a purge and the Hollowmere invalidation queue is wedged, use break-glass to flush the edge tier directly. Contractors: get verbal sign-off from the catalog lead first. Steps: open the Hollowmere admin shell, select emergency-flush, confirm the tenant, and run it once — repeated flushes thrash the origin. Access is logged and expires after 20 minutes. Unseal the admin shell with the passphrase below.

recovery phrase for kahop-tajog: istix-casvan

Title: Payroll export column order changed without notice in Ledgerly 4.2

Plugin authors: the CSV export now emits deduction columns before earnings columns, breaking any parser that relied on position rather than headers. This was an intentional change to match the Fennwick accounting spec, but it shipped without a deprecation window. Fix your plugins to key off header names. The change landed in the build identified below.

build token for yajof-bajof: htk31_506ff1188f74596b5bb2eec94edc43c